We provide extensive care for all stages of pregnancy, birth and child health. Every birth is a celebration, a normal, healthy process. Pregnancy and birth are unique for each individual.
Our unit has bright and spacious labour and delivery suites to accommodate and support you during labour and birth. Our staff always strive to provide culturally sensitive care during your stay and are committed to meeting your birthing wishes and desires.
The MGH team includes highly trained obstetricians, midwives, family doctors, nurses, social workers, pharmacists, dieticians, certified childbirth educators and lactation consultants. Given our affiliation with The University of Toronto and other academic institutions, your care team may also involve students and learners.
